Students can only give JEE mains after passing class 12th with minimum required marks. 11th class students cannot give the JEE mains examination. So, if you wish to give JEE mains only, then you can give only JEE mains examination but that could only be possible when you will pass the class 12th with minimum required percentage.
Further, the eligibility criteria to give JEE mains 2022 examination is as follows :
Students should have passed the 12th class or qualifying the exam in 2020 or 2021.
Candidates appearing in 12th class or equivalent qualifying exams in 2022 can also apply.
There is no age limit for giving JEE mains examination
Students can appear in the JEE Main exam for three consecutive years.
